Abstract

Electrically controlled color imaging with a mixture of electrophotosensitive particles of different color types is effected using a photoconductive insulator layer as a particle addressing electrode. A layer of such mixture adjacent the electrode is uniformly exposed by time-separated, different-color, light pulses and discrete portions of the photoconductor are selectively addressed, by activating radiation, in synchronization with the pulses and according to the image information of color image to be reproduced.
